James Michael (Mikey) Orick, age 50, of Jacksboro passed away Tuesday, June 5, 2018.
He was a member of Ivy Grove Missionary Baptist Church, a graduate of LMU and worked for Woodson Cash Stores for over 20 years, a member of Campbell County School board for ten years and five years as Chairman. He enjoyed Politics, loved his dogs, and had a great desire to help people. Mike did not have any children, but he loved and was so proud of his nieces and nephews.
Preceded in death by parents, Charles & Shirley Goad Orick; brothers, Charles Edward Orick, Curtis Lee Orick; best friend, Randy Comer; grandparents, Lawrence & Icie Orick, Marion & Hazel Goad. He was currently employed at Crook & Orick Real Estate Appraisal in Knoxville
